Peenoun

urine

Peeverb

To urinate.

Peeverb

To drizzle.

Peenoun

See 1st Pea.

Peenoun

Bill of an anchor. See Peak, 3 (c).

Peenoun

Urine.

Peenoun

The act of urinating; - used in the informal take a pee, meaning, to urinate.

Peeverb

To urinate.

Peenoun

liquid excretory product;

Peenoun

informal terms for urination;

Peeverb

eliminate urine;

Poonoun

alternative spelling of pooh: an instance of saying "poo".

Poonoun

Feces.

Poonoun

A piece of feces or an act of defecation.

Poonoun

Marijuana resin.

Poonoun

champagne

Poonoun

short form of shampoo

Pooverb

alternative spelling of pooh: to say "poo".

Pooverb

To defecate.

Pooverb

To dirty something with feces.

Poointerjection

alternative spelling of pooh: Expressing dismissal, disgust, etc.

Poointerjection

(euphemistic) Expressing annoyance, frustration, etc.: a minced oath for 'shit'.
